Heroes who are biologically in the same family as villains. They can be parents, siblings, sons/daughters, grandparents, grandchildren, ancestors, descendants, distant relatives, cousins, uncles/aunts, nieces/nephews, or even clones of villains. They can also be distant family members or clones of villains. Adoptive and foster relatives and heroes who have villain clones can also count as well. A popular element in fiction is to have the protagonist be related to a villain to add more drama. This was most likely popularized by the relationship between Luke Skywalker and Darth Vader (who turns out to be Anakin Skywalker).
This is the updated version of Heroes who are biologically related to the villain.
In some cases, a villain's relative may qualify as Pure Good if they meet all criteria, such as having empathy (e.g. affection and/or remorse) for the villain. In addition to many cases, trying to convince them to redeem themselves, though this can sometimes turn out to be a total failure, especially if the villain meets the criteria of Pure Evil.
